Top definition
Leeham is the name you MUST yell out when a friend makes a noise like a goose by inhaling sharply, or when an actual goose is honking. Leeham originated as a small child, who was beaten half to death when mistakenly thought to have produced a goose like noise to irritate his father.
by randytree January 20, 2011
